To begin with this recipe, we have to first prepare a few components. You can cook simple goulash american made using 7 ingredients and 6 steps. Here is how you cook it.

The ingredients needed to make Simple goulash American made:
  1. Prepare 1 (28)oz canned diced tomatoes, undrained
  2. Prepare 1 (16)oz box elbow macaroni, cooked
  3. Get 1 lb ground chuck, optional, cooked
  4. Get 1/2 cup ketchup
  5. Take 1/2 cup dill pickle juice
  6. Get 1 chopped onion
  7. Make ready to taste Salt & pepper

American goulash is made with a tomato baste, ground beef, and elbow macaroni. Topped with a variety of seasoning to give it that rich, savory flavor. I actually remember eating this in elementary school. One of my favorites back when school lunches were actually good.

Steps to make Simple goulash American made:
  1. Boil & drain elbow macaroni
  2. Cook ground chuck
  3. Saute the onion
  4. Add together remaining ingredients
  5. Now add macaroni
  6. Cook together until absorbed thus creating a sauce.
